How to Become a Travel Agent in New Orleans

Travel agents in New Orleans can receive their training online from a top post-secondary institution or a host agency. The profession does not require a license, so the choice of training arrangement is down to individual preferences.

Once properly trained, candidates are advised to join a host agency to start. This way, they will have access to the host agency’s resources and be able to get into the job easily.

Travel agents highly value certification. As such, candidates may consider joining a professional organization like the ASTA (American Society of Travel Advisors) and becoming certified.

The University of New Orleans

Online, LA Online Only

The University of New Orleans, specifically its Division of Professional, Adult, and Continuing Education, offers an excellent Travel Agent training program. The program includes 100 hours of instruction and six months of access to instructional materials.
